The Green House, Bournemouth
About the Hotel
The Green House is a beautifully restored, 32-room Grade II Victorian villa in Bournemouth. It is ideally situated between Dorset's renowned blue-flag golden beaches and the ancient New Forest. The hotel has been recognized as one of the world's top eco-hotels, focusing on sustainability and environmental impact.
Location
The hotel is located just 1 km from Bournemouth Central and offers easy access to the town's beaches and attractions. Nearby sites include Corfe Castle, Beaulieu Abbey, and Monkey World, with ample public transportation options available. The property's sustainability efforts include free EV charging stations.
Rooms
The Green House offers 32 stunning guest rooms with bespoke, handcrafted furniture made from sustainable materials. Rooms are categorized into small doubles, classic doubles, large doubles, and deluxe doubles, featuring luxurious goose-down duvets and organic bed linen. Each room comes equipped with a 32-inch LED flat-screen TV and a modern bathroom with luxury toiletries. Some rooms include a Victorian roll-top bath and walk-in showers.
Eat & Drink
The hotel's Arbor restaurant, led by multi-award-winning Head Chef Andy Hilton, specializes in seasonal dishes crafted from local and organic ingredients. The à la carte menu is reasonably priced, and the bar features the UK's widest range of organic spirits. Guests can enjoy a three-course meal featuring local produce and innovative dishes like cured mackerel and local lamb shoulder.
Leisure & Business
The Green House provides adaptable conference spaces for business meetings, accommodating anywhere from 10 to 84 attendees. A professional events team supports corporate functions, emphasizing sustainability in their offerings. Guests can also relax on the peaceful terrace, ideal for informal gatherings or special occasions.
